🎵 Raspberry Pi Pico แทน SID Chip ได้จริงเหรอ?
เทคโนโลยีใหม่ฟื้นคืนชีพเสียงคลาสสิกจาก Commodore 64
SID Chip หรือ Sound Interface Device คือหัวใจของเสียงใน Commodore 64 ที่สร้างเสียง 8-bit อันเป็นเอกลักษณ์และเป็นที่รักของผู้คนทั่วโลก แต่ปัญหาคือ Chip ตัวนี้หายากและราคาแพงมากในปัจจุบัน โชคดีที่เทคโนโลยีสมัยใหม่ได้เข้ามาช่วย! ด้วย Raspberry Pi Pico ที่มีราคาไม่ถึง 100 บาท เราสามารถจำลองเสียงของ SID Chip แบบ Original ได้อย่างน่าทึ่ง บทความนี้จะพาคุณไปทำความรู้จักกับโซลูชั่นสมัยใหม่ 2 ตัวที่กำลังได้รับความนิยมในหมู่ผู้รักเครื่อง Retro Computer คือ ARMSID และ SIDKick Pico พร้อมเปรียบเทียบข้อดีข้อเสียของแต่ละตัว และวิธีเลือกให้เหมาะกับความต้องการของคุณ

🔊 SID Chip คืออะไร?
SID Chip (Sound Interface Device) เป็น Sound Chip ตำนานที่ออกแบบโดย Bob Yannes ใน ปี 1981 สำหรับ Commodore 64 ซึ่งเป็นคอมพิวเตอร์ที่ขายดีที่สุดในประวัติศาสตร์ Chip ตัวนี้มีความสามารถในการสร้างเสียงแบบ Analog Synthesis ที่ซับซ้อนมาก มี 3 Oscillators สามารถสร้าง Waveform หลายรูปแบบ (Triangle, Sawtooth, Pulse, Noise) มี Filter ที่สามารถปรับแต่งได้ และ ADSR Envelope Generator สำหรับแต่ละ Voice เสียงที่ออกมาจาก SID Chip มีความอบอุ่นและมีเอกลักษณ์เฉพาะตัว ทำให้เป็นที่รักของนักดนตรี Chiptune และผู้สะสม Retro Hardware ทั่วโลก ปัจจุบัน SID Chip ตัวจริงหายากมากและราคาสูงถึงหลายพันบาทต่อชิป ทำให้การหาตัวทดแทนที่มีคุณภาพเป็นเรื่องสำคัญมาก
จุดเด่นของ SID Chip:
- 3 Independent Voices: สามารถเล่นเสียง 3 เสียงพร้อมกันได้
- Multiple Waveforms: Triangle, Sawtooth, Pulse (แบบปรับ Width ได้), White Noise
- Multi-mode Filter: Low-pass, High-pass, Band-pass แบบปรับแต่งได้
- Ring Modulation & Sync: สร้างเสียงที่ซับซ้อนและไม่เหมือนใคร
- ADSR Envelope: ควบคุม Attack, Decay, Sustain, Release ของแต่ละเสียง
⚡ ARMSID - รุ่นแรกสุดของการ Emulation
ARMSID เป็น SID Replacement ที่ออกแบบโดย Nobomi จากสาธารณรัฐเช็ก เป็นหนึ่งในโซลูชั่นแรกๆ ที่ใช้ Microcontroller สมัยใหม่มาจำลอง SID Chip ARMSID ใช้ ARM Cortex-M3 Microcontroller (STM32F103) ที่มีความเร็วสูงพอที่จะ Emulate การทำงานของ SID Chip แบบ Real-time ได้ คุณสมบัติเด่นของ ARMSID คือมี 2 โหมดการทำงาน: SID 6581 (รุ่นแรกที่มีเสียง Filter ที่อบอุ่น) และ SID 8580 (รุ่นใหม่ที่มี Filter ที่คมชัดกว่า) ผู้ใช้สามารถสลับระหว่างโหมดได้ตามต้องการ นอกจากนี้ยังมีการจำลอง Filter Characteristics ที่แม่นยำมาก ทำให้เสียงที่ได้ใกล้เคียงกับ SID Chip ตัวจริงมาก ARMSID มีทั้งรุ่น Standard และรุ่น Ultimate ที่มีฟีเจอร์เพิ่มเติม เช่น การบันทึกเสียงเป็นไฟล์ MP3 ได้โดยตรง
💡 ข้อดี: สามารถเลือกโหมด 6581 หรือ 8580 ได้ มี Filter ที่จำลองได้ใกล้เคียงกับของจริง และมีรุ่น Ultimate ที่บันทึกเสียงเป็น MP3 ได้
🥧 SIDKick Pico - ทางเลือกใหม่ที่ถูกและดี
SIDKick Pico เป็น SID Replacement รุ่นใหม่ที่ใช้ Raspberry Pi Pico ซึ่งมีราคาถูกมาก (ประมาณ 80-100 บาท) แต่มี Performance สูงมากด้วย Dual-core ARM Cortex-M0+ ที่ 133 MHz โปรเจกต์นี้พัฒนาโดย Community และเป็น Open Source ทำให้ใครก็สามารถนำไป Build เองได้ การติดตั้งง่ายมาก เพียงแค่ลบ SID Chip ตัวเดิมออก และเสียบ Raspberry Pi Pico ที่ Flash Firmware SIDKick ลงไปแทน SIDKick Pico สามารถจำลองการทำงานของ SID Chip ได้แบบ Cycle-accurate คือแม่นยำถึงระดับ CPU Cycle ทำให้เกม และโปรแกรมที่ใช้ SID Chip แบบซับซ้อน เช่น การใช้เทคนิค Sample Playback หรือ Digi-samples ก็สามารถทำงานได้ถูกต้อง นอกจากนี้ยังมีฟีเจอร์พิเศษ เช่น การ Emulate SID Chip ได้หลายแบบพร้อมกัน (Dual SID, Triple SID) สำหรับเพลงที่ต้องการเสียงหลาย Chip
🔗 อ่านเพิ่มเติม:
สามารถหาข้อมูลเพิ่มเติมเกี่ยวกับ SIDKick Pico ได้ที่ C64 Wiki - SIDKick Pico และดาวน์โหลด Firmware ได้ที่ GitHub
วิดีโอเปรียบเทียบ Modern SID Chip Substitutes จาก Ben Eater
⚖️ เปรียบเทียบ ARMSID vs SIDKick Pico
🔷 ARMSID
ข้อดี: Filter ที่แม่นยำมาก สลับโหมด 6581/8580 ได้ รุ่น Ultimate บันทึกเป็น MP3 ได้ Plug-and-play ไม่ต้องติดตั้งเอง
ข้อเสีย: ราคาแพงกว่า (ประมาณ 2,000-3,000 บาท) หาซื้อยากกว่า ไม่ใช่ Open Source
เหมาะสำหรับ: คนที่ต้องการความสะดวก ไม่อยากประกอบเอง และต้องการ Filter ที่ใกล้เคียง SID จริงมากที่สุด
🥧 SIDKick Pico
ข้อดี: ราคาถูกมาก (80-100 บาท) Open Source สามารถ DIY ได้ Cycle-accurate Emulation รองรับ Dual/Triple SID Community Support ดี
ข้อเสีย: ต้องติดตั้งและ Flash Firmware เอง Filter อาจไม่แม่นยำเท่า ARMSID ในบางกรณี
เหมาะสำหรับ: Hobbyist ที่ชอบ DIY ต้องการประหยัดงบ และอยากเรียนรู้เกี่ยวกับ Hardware Emulation
🛠️ ทั้งสองตัวเลือกนี้:
- ทำงานได้กับ Commodore 64 และ 128 ทุกรุ่น
- ใช้พลังงานน้อยกว่า SID Chip ตัวจริง (ไม่ร้อนเหมือนของเดิม)
- ไม่ต้องกังวลเรื่อง SID Chip เดิมเสื่อมสภาพ
- รองรับเกมและโปรแกรมเกือบทั้งหมดที่เคยทำมาสำหรับ C64
🎯 ควรเลือกตัวไหน?
การเลือกระหว่าง ARMSID และ SIDKick Pico ขึ้นอยู่กับความต้องการและงบประมาณของคุณ หากคุณเป็น Audiophile ที่ต้องการเสียงที่แม่นยำที่สุด มีงบประมาณพอ และไม่อยากยุ่งยากในการติดตั้ง ARMSID คือทางเลือกที่ดี โดยเฉพาะรุ่น Ultimate ที่สามารถบันทึกเสียงเป็น MP3 ได้โดยตรง เหมาะสำหรับนักดนตรี Chiptune แต่หากคุณเป็น Hobbyist ที่ชอบ DIY มีงบจำกัด หรืออยากเรียนรู้เกี่ยวกับ Hardware Emulation SIDKick Pico คือตัวเลือกที่ยอดเยี่ยม ราคาถูกมาก ติดตั้งไม่ยาก และมี Community ที่แข็งแรงพร้อมช่วยเหลือ นอกจากนี้ถ้าคุณต้องการทดลองกับ Dual SID หรือ Triple SID Setup SIDKick Pico สามารถทำได้ในราคาที่ประหยัดกว่ามาก ทั้งสองตัวเลือกนี้ล้วนเป็นโซลูชั่นที่ยอดเยี่ยมในการฟื้นฟูและรักษาเครื่อง Commodore 64 ของคุณให้ทำงานได้อีกหลายสิบปี
📝 สรุป: อนาคตของ Retro Computing
การที่เราสามารถใช้เทคโนโลยีสมัยใหม่อย่าง Raspberry Pi Pico ที่ราคาไม่ถึง 100 บาทมาจำลองเสียงของ SID Chip ที่เคยมีราคาหลายพันบาทได้อย่างแม่นยำ นั่นแสดงให้เห็นถึงพลังของ Open Source Hardware และ Community ที่รักและอนุรักษ์ Retro Technology ทั้ง ARMSID และ SIDKick Pico ล้วนเป็นตัวอย่างที่ดีของการนำเทคโนโลยีใหม่มาช่วยรักษาและฟื้นฟูเทคโนโลยีเก่าให้คงอยู่ต่อไป ไม่ว่าคุณจะเลือกตัวไหน คุณจะได้เสียง 8-bit คุณภาพสูงที่สามารถเล่นเกมและเพลง Chiptune จาก Commodore 64 ได้อย่างเต็มที่ โดยไม่ต้องกังวลว่า SID Chip ตัวเดิมจะเสื่อมสภาพหรือหาซื้อไม่ได้ นี่คืออนาคตของ Retro Computing ที่ทุกคนสามารถเข้าถึงได้!
ต้องการ Raspberry Pi Pico สำหรับโปรเจกต์ Retro ของคุณ?
ช้อป Raspberry Pi Pico ที่ Globalbyteshop